This conference is aimed at using technology for
instruction by showcasing the latest in classroom applications, displaying
software and hardware, and providing sessions and workshops dealing with
issues of technology in today’s schools. Topics include, but are not limited
to educational computing, innovative uses of software, multimedia, funding,
telecommunications, and technology planning and should be geared toward
elementary and/or secondary teachers, tech directors, library/media
specialists, and/or administrators. Presentations should focus on the
integration of technology in today’s classrooms.
We will offer preconference and breakout session formats.
Preconference sessions of three hours in length, will be held on Tuesday,
March 4, with audiences restricted to 20-30 attendees. Breakout sessions of
fifty minutes in length, will be held on Wednesday, March 5, with variable
audience sizes of 10-60 attendees. Please consider presenting either a fifty
minute breakout session, or if your topic requires in-depth study, please
consider presenting a three hour morning or afternoon preconference session.
